Designing Product Description Pages That Sell

Product recommendation is one of the ways of showing how usability practices can increase online sales. Making your users’ life easier will improve the whole shopping experience and will make buying fun!

"Design your product description page including related products…"

Make shopping easy and people will buy more. Design your product description page including related products that customers might like to buy.

Abercrombie & Fitch Product Description Page

 

A good design example is the Abercrombie & Fitch website, is you are looking for shorts it will show you a shirt and shoes to combine them with on the "Complete The Look" section.

Making this kind of integration takes time as it requires to internally link products, but all this effort could be extremely rewarding. Read other Design vs Art articles about Compulsive Shopping and Product Recommendations.

Design for Online Compulsive Shopping

Compulsive shopping could be recognise as an addiction that make retailers happy. They just offer customers things they might like to buy. At the beginning of the internet shopping many thought that compulsive shopping would disappear in the online era, but reality is very far from those wrong predictions.

Compulsive shopping could also be promoted online, some online retailers are doing it better than others thanks to a better design. For example Nordstrom is doing it well, recommending users similar products.

Yahoo! Shopping gives users a lot of valuable information about the products and also recommends alternative products for those with poor user rating. In this example, I was checking a digital camera that has only a 2-stars rating, so Yahoo! shows me similar products other users were looking at.

Amazon goes one step farther and asks users to rate some products bought recently to use this information to make better product recommendations. It can not be better, once again Amazon is doing very good.
